What does a website cost?

More than a template and less than an agency — but the honest answer is that it depends on scope, and anyone quoting a number before understanding your business is guessing. Four things move the price: how many pages you need, whether content exists or has to be created, what has to function beyond publishing pages (booking, e-commerce, member areas, integrations), and how much of the ongoing care you want handled. A five-page site for an established firm with copy already written sits at one end. A sixteen-page site with e-commerce and photography direction sits at the other. Either way you get a single fixed project price in writing before any work starts, and it does not move unless you change the scope. No hourly meter, no surprise invoices.

Do you use page builders like Elementor or Divi?

No. Page builders add markup and CSS weight that work against Core Web Vitals, and they make sites harder to maintain later. We build custom block themes with design tokens in theme.json, which keeps the editor familiar and the front end fast.

Who owns the site, the domain, and the hosting?

You do — all three, from the start. We build on our own server, then help you set up hosting and register the domain in your name, on your own account, paid by you. When the site is ready we migrate it to your hosting. For clients on a care plan we work through delegate access, so we can maintain the site without ever holding your password. Nothing is rented from us, and if you ever want to take the site to another developer, everything goes with you.
